Barcelona are saving their number four shirt for Cesc Fabregas - even though his transfer saga has turned ugly.
The Spanish giants are privately making it clear they will not match Arsenal's £40million asking price and relations between the clubs are at an all-time low.
The mayor of Arenys de Munt, Fabregas' hometown, has even waded in, accusing the Gunners of "kidnapping" the Spanish midfielder.
Politician Estanislao Fors said: "It is necessary to behave well and stop this. This is like a kidnapping and they must let him go."
